第一章 概述

第一章单元测试

1、单选题:
‎根据Kerchoffs假设,密码体制的安全性仅依赖于对       的保密,而不应依赖于对密码算法的保密。‏
选项:
A: 密码算法
B: 密文
C: 明文的统计特性
D: 密钥
答案: 【 密钥

2、单选题:
‎如果一个密码体制的加密密钥与解密密钥相同,则称其为        。‎
选项:
A: 对称密钥密码体制
B: 非对称密钥密码体制
C: 公钥密码体制
D: 双钥密码体制
答案: 【 对称密钥密码体制

3、单选题:
‏采用恺撒(Caesar)密码,对明文nice进行加密所产生的密文是        。‏
选项:
A: pkeg
B: kfzb
C: ojdf
D: qlfh
答案: 【 qlfh

4、单选题:
​设乘法密码的加密函数为c=11m(mod 26),则其解密密钥为        。​
选项:
A: 11
B: 7
C: 19
D: 23
答案: 【 19

5、单选题:
‎仿射密码加密函数为c=17m+2(mod 26),则其解密函数为       。​
选项:
A: m=3c+6(mod 26)
B: m=23c+6(mod 26)
C: m=3c-2(mod 26)
D: m=23c-2(mod 26)
答案: 【 m=23c+6(mod 26)

6、单选题:
‌在密码学中,我们把没有加密的信息称为明文,加密后的信息称为      。‏
选项:
A: 摘要
B: 签名
C: 密文
D: 认证码
答案: 【 密文

7、单选题:
​使用有效资源对一个密码系统进行分析而未能破译,则该密码是       的。‍
选项:
A: 计算上安全
B: 无条件安全
C: 不可破译
D: 不安全
答案: 【 计算上安全

8、单选题:
           算法抵抗频率分析攻击能力最强,而抵抗已知明文攻击较弱。‎‌‎
选项:
A: 维吉利亚密码
B: 仿射密码
C: 希尔密码
D: 转轮密码
答案: 【 希尔密码

9、单选题:
‎密码分析学中,密码分析者知道要破解的密文,还知道一些明文及其相应的密文,这一类攻击称为        。‎
选项:
A: 唯密文攻击
B: 已知明文攻击
C: 选择明文攻击
D: 选择密文攻击
答案: 【 已知明文攻击

10、单选题:
‎1976年,提出公钥密码体制概念的学者是       。‍
选项:
A: Hill和Hellman
B: Bauer和Hellman
C: Diffie和Bauer
D: Diffie和Hellman
答案: 【 Diffie和Hellman

11、单选题:
‍密码学的两个分支是          和密码分析学。其中前者是对信息进行编码以保护信息的一门学问,后者是研究分析破译密码的学问。‍
选项:
A: 密码编码学
B: 密码设计学
C: 密码应用
D: 密码协议
答案: 【 密码编码学

12、单选题:
​1917年,Mauborbne和Vernam提出了一种理想的加密方案,称为         密码体制,被认为是无条件安全的密码体制。‎
选项:
A: 一次一密
B: 序列
C: 分组
D: 公钥
答案: 【 一次一密

13、单选题:
‏1949年         发表了“保密系统的通信理论”一文,这篇文章奠定了密码学的理论基础,推动着密码学从艺术向科学的转变。‌
选项:
A: Shannon
B: Diffie
C: Hellman
D: Shamir
答案: 【 Shannon

14、单选题:
‏加法密码的一个典型代表是恺撒(Caesar)密码,它是加法密码当密钥k=      时的特例。​
选项:
A: 3
B: 5
C: 2
D: 7
答案: 【 3

15、单选题:
‌在仿射密码函数y=ax+b(mod 26)中,加密密钥为        。‏
选项:
A: a,b
B: 26
C: a,x
D: x,a,b
答案: 【 a,b

随堂测验1

1、单选题:
‍机密性指的是(     )‍
选项:
A: 消息来源的真实性
B: 数据未被未授权篡改或者损坏
C: 特定行为和结果的一致性
D: 保证信息为授权者使用而不泄漏给未经授权者
答案: 【 保证信息为授权者使用而不泄漏给未经授权者

2、多选题:
‍下列属于对称密钥密码体制的有(     )​
选项:
A: 流密码
B: 公钥密码
C: 分组密码
D: 数字签名
答案: 【 流密码;
分组密码

随堂测验2

1、单选题:
​第一代公开的、完全说明细节的商业级密码标准是(      )‎
选项:
A: AES
B: DES
C: RSA
D: 杰弗逊圆盘
答案: 【 DES

2、判断题:
‏第一个公钥加密算法是由Diffie和Hellman提出的。‎
选项:
A: 正确
B: 错误
答案: 【 错误

随堂测验3

1、单选题:
‏Kerckhoff假设指的是密码体制的安全性仅依赖于(     )的保密。​
选项:
A: 密钥
B: 密文
C: 明文
D: 公钥
答案: 【 密钥

2、单选题:
‎根据密码分析者可能取得的分析资料不同,可将密码分析分为(    )​
选项:
A: 搭线监听、电磁窃听、流量分析
B: 惟密文攻击、已知明文攻击、选择明文攻击、选择密文攻击
C: 穷举攻击、统计分析攻击、解密变化攻击
D: 删除、篡改、重放、伪造
答案: 【 惟密文攻击、已知明文攻击、选择明文攻击、选择密文攻击

3、多选题:
‍密码分析学的目标在于破译(      )​
选项:
A: 明文
B: 密文
C: 密钥
D: 算法结构
答案: 【 密文;
密钥

4、多选题:
‎加密算法只需要满足两条准则之一,就称为是计算上安全。这两条准则是(     )。‏
选项:
A: 无论截获多少密文,都没有足够信息来唯一确定明文
B: 破译密文的代价超过被加密信息的价值。
C: 密钥和明文一样长。
D: 破译密文所花的时间超过信息的有用期。
答案: 【 破译密文的代价超过被加密信息的价值。;
破译密文所花的时间超过信息的有用期。

随堂测验4

1、单选题:
‍仿射密码y=ax+b(mod 26)有可用密钥(      )个。‏
选项:
A: 26
B: 12
C: 312
D: 256
答案: 【 312

第二章 流密码

第二章单元测验

1、单选题:
‍序列密码属于             。‏
选项:
A: 非对称密码体制
B: 对称密码体制
C: 双钥密码体制
D: 公钥密码体制
答案: 【 对称密码体制

2、单选题:
‍n级m序列的周期为      。‍
选项:
A: n
B:
C:
D:
答案: 【 

3、单选题:

设一个3级线性反馈移位寄存器(LFSR)的递推关系式为,则其输出序列周期为       

‏选项:
A: 3
B: 7
C: 2
D: 1
答案: 【 7

4、单选题:
 n级m序列的一个周期内,长为n-1的1游程有       个。‎‏‎
选项:
A: 0
B: 1
C: 2
D: n
答案: 【 0

5、单选题:
​n级m序列的一个周期内,0出现的次数为        。‌
选项:
A: n
B:
C:
D:
答案: 【 

6、单选题:
n级线性反馈移位寄存器最多有       不同的非零状态。​‏​
选项:
A: n
B:
C:
D:
答案: 【 

7、单选题:
‍Golomb对伪随机周期序列提出了3个随机性公设,其中,在序列的一个周期内,长为i的游程占游程总数的     。‌
选项:
A:
B:
C:
D:
答案: 【 

8、单选题:
以下关于序列密码的说法正确的是          。‌‌‌
选项:
A: 序列密码输出的密钥流是周期序列
B: 序列密码是非对称密钥密码算法
C: 序列密码可提供认证
D: 序列密码加密算法中,明文的不同会影响密钥流的输出
答案: 【 序列密码输出的密钥流是周期序列

9、单选题:
‍Golomb随机性公设要求,在序列的一个周期内,0与1的个数相差至多为  &nbs

剩余75%内容付费后可查看

发表评论

电子邮件地址不会被公开。 必填项已用*标注